| from __future__ import annotations | ||||
| from ansible.plugins.lookup import LookupBase | ||||
| from ansible.errors import AnsibleError | ||||
| import os | ||||
|  | ||||
| class LookupModule(LookupBase): |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|     Return a cache-busting string based on the LOCAL file's mtime. | ||||
|  | ||||
|     Usage (single path → string via Jinja): | ||||
|       {{ lookup('local_mtime_qs', '/path/to/file.css') }} | ||||
|       -> "?version=1712323456" | ||||
|  | ||||
|     Options: | ||||
|       param (str): query parameter name (default: "version") | ||||
|       mode  (str): "qs" (default) → returns "?<param>=<mtime>" | ||||
|                    "epoch"        → returns "<mtime>" | ||||
|  | ||||
|     Multiple paths (returns list, one result per term): | ||||
|       {{ lookup('local_mtime_qs', '/a.js', '/b.js', param='v') }} | ||||
|     """ | ||||
|  | ||||
|     def run(self, terms, variables=None, **kwargs): | ||||
|         if not terms: | ||||
|             return [] | ||||
|  | ||||
|         param = kwargs.get('param', 'version') | ||||
|         mode  = kwargs.get('mode', 'qs') | ||||
|  | ||||
|         if mode not in ('qs', 'epoch'): | ||||
|             raise AnsibleError("local_mtime_qs: 'mode' must be 'qs' or 'epoch'") | ||||
|  | ||||
|         results = [] | ||||
|         for term in terms: | ||||
|             path = os.path.abspath(os.path.expanduser(str(term))) | ||||
|  | ||||
|             # Fail fast if path is missing or not a regular file | ||||
|             if not os.path.exists(path): | ||||
|                 raise AnsibleError(f"local_mtime_qs: file does not exist: {path}") | ||||
|             if not os.path.isfile(path): | ||||
|                 raise AnsibleError(f"local_mtime_qs: not a regular file: {path}") | ||||
|  | ||||
|             try: | ||||
|                 mtime = int(os.stat(path).st_mtime) | ||||
|             except OSError as e: | ||||
|                 raise AnsibleError(f"local_mtime_qs: cannot stat '{path}': {e}") | ||||
|  | ||||
|             if mode == 'qs': | ||||
|                 results.append(f"?{param}={mtime}") | ||||
|             else:  # mode == 'epoch' | ||||
|                 results.append(str(mtime)) | ||||
|  | ||||
|         return results | ||||
